WebFeb 12, 2024 · If you have a bed that slides on your wood floor, there are a few things you can do to stop it. First, try placing a rug under the bed. This will provide friction and help keep the bed from sliding. If that doesn’t work, you can try … WebFeb 12, 2024 · There are a few things you can do to keep your furniture from sliding on wood. One is to use furniture pads. These are thin, round discs that go under the legs of your furniture and help to grip the floor and prevent slipping. You can find them at most hardware stores. Another option is to use adhesive strips or nonslip mats.

Place … WebOct 29, 2024 · If your furniture is sliding on your hardwood floors, there are a few things you can do to stop it. First, try placing a rug or mat under the legs of the furniture. This will provide traction and prevent the furniture from sliding. If that doesn’t work, you can try using double-sided tape or adhesive pads to keep the furniture in place.

WebUse an Area Rug. An area rug that has a pad safe for laminate and wood floors also helps keep furniture from slipping. For a living room, consider placing one end of the area rug beneath the front legs of a sofa, for instance. Side chairs can sit elsewhere around the perimeter of the rug.
